This photo by Mainichi photographer Kenji Ikai titled "Exhausted on the final corner," featuring skaters at the 2022 Beijing Olympic Games, won a silver award in the Kansai Press Photographers Association awards. Pictured fallen on the ice at left is Japanese speed skater Nana Takagi. In the center is Miho Takagi and at right is Ayano Sato. (Mainichi)

This photo by Daiki Takikawa titled "Like a battlefield" won a gold award in the news category of the Kansai Press Photographers Association awards. The photo, taken on July 8, 2022, shows an investigator holding what appears to be a firearm seized from the home of Tetsuya Yamagami, the man suspected of assassinating former Prime Minister Shinzo Abe. (Mainichi)
